Gleam, a popular engagement and marketing platform, has announced its integration with Tangled, a rising player in marketing automation software. This development allows users of Tangled to access Gleam’s tools directly within their existing workflows, potentially expanding Gleam’s user base and offering more comprehensive automation options.

The integration was officially announced on March 15, 2024, by both companies through their respective communication channels. According to Gleam, this move aims to streamline campaign management and enhance user engagement capabilities for Tangled customers.

While the full scope of the integration features is still being detailed, initial statements indicate that users will be able to incorporate Gleam’s contest, referral, and reward features directly within Tangled’s platform. The companies have emphasized that this collaboration is designed to improve automation efficiency and data synchronization across systems.

Background on Gleam and Tangled Collaborations

Gleam has established itself as a leading provider of engagement marketing tools, including contests, rewards, and referral programs, used by brands worldwide. Meanwhile, Tangled has been gaining traction as a marketing automation platform that offers workflow automation, customer segmentation, and analytics.

Prior to this integration, Gleam primarily operated as a standalone tool with integrations into various platforms. Tangled, on the other hand, has been expanding its ecosystem through partnerships to enhance its automation capabilities. This latest move reflects a strategic effort by both companies to create a more seamless marketing experience for their users.
